We have extensive experience in working on a variety of rail projects, in locations across the UK.

Fussey Engineering offer a complete package in structural steelwork for rail including, design, detailed fabrication drawings, fabrication, welding, finishing in paint or galvanise as required and erection.

Our men hold all relevant qualifications to work in this areas, including PTS (Personal Track Safety) qualifications.

Projects we have done in this area include:

 

  • Ipswich Station Footbridge – New footbridge to incorporate ‘step free access’
  • Lincoln Station Footbridge – New bridge fabricated and erected, with refurbishment of stairs following original bridge demolition
  • Peterborough Railway Station– Anti-vandal screening on rail footbridge
  • London-Liverpool line – Protective screening erected just south of Milton Keynes during weekend possession
  • Streatham Railway Station – Steel access walkways for the station in Streatham, south London
